Canton Township is a township in McPherson County, Kansas, in the United States. [1] Canton Township was organized in 1874. [2]

Canton is a city in McPherson County, Kansas, United States. [1] As of the 2020 census , the population of the city was 685. [ 5 ] It is named after Canton, Ohio .

Nichols Hall is a building on the campus of Kansas State University. This building was originally built in 1911 and appears from the exterior as a castle with battlements . Its interior was destroyed by fire in 1968; the structure was rebuilt in 1985.
